About Landrace Origin

Landrace Origin refers to cannabis genetics that descend from traditional, regionally-adapted populations developed over centuries in specific geographic areas—often before modern international breeding. These strains evolved naturally or through informal selection within their native environments, producing distinct phenotypic traits suited to local climate, altitude, and soil conditions. Landrace populations typically show genetic diversity and variable expression, unlike modern stabilized hybrids. Common landrace regions include the Hindu Kush mountains, Colombian highlands, Thai lowlands, and Moroccan Rif valleys. Breeders frequently study landraces to understand regional cannabinoid and terpene profiles, plant structure adaptations, and genetic backgrounds that inform contemporary breeding programs. Breeder relevance

Breeders working with landrace genetics seek to understand region-specific traits—flowering times adapted to local photoperiods, pest resistance developed through natural selection, and terpene profiles shaped by climate. Landrace crosses often serve as foundational stock for creating stable hybrid lines while capturing heritage genetic characteristics.
